Neonatal hypoxic-ischemic encephalopathy characterized by CT and prognosis of
[Abstract] Objective: To investigate the hypoxic-ischemic encephalopathy (HIE) of the CT performance characteristics and prognosis. Methods: 58 cases of HIE children were analyzed retrospectively studied and analyzed the performance of its CT features and prognosis. Results: 58 cases of HIE in this group, mild in 20 cases, moderate in 22 cases, severe in 16 cases. In 30 cases with intracranial hemorrhage, follow-up review found 17 cases returned to normal; other 13 cases, 2 deaths, 11 cases were cerebral softening, cerebral atrophy, cerebral penetrating malformation, cerebral calcification and other sequelae of the performance of irreversibility. Conclusion: The different types of HIE, a different prognosis.
[Keywords:] neonatal hypoxic-ischemic encephalopathy; tomography; X-ray computed

Neonatal hypoxic-ischemic encephalopathy (hypoxic ischemic encephalopathy, HIE) is a result of perinatal hypoxia-induced neonatal brain lesions, is a severe complication of neonatal asphyxia. Clinical manifestations of irritability, excitement or inhibition, muscle tension changes, weakening or disappearance of primitive reflexes, convulsions, or respiratory disorder such as [1], the disease has certain performance characteristics of CT.
